And barbarians (or any large race) looks to you like you are moving slow,
but if you look from any other F9 positions they aren't (compared to
others). Go from a barbarian to a small race like a halfling, they look
like they are ALWAYS with accelerando because they are closer to the ground.
Just like in a car, if you look directly out the window at the ground it
goes by much faster than if you look farther out.
